<h3>what is Antarctica? </h3>

Antarctica The least inhabited and most southern continent on Earth is. It encompasses the geographical South Pole and is almost fully south of the Antarctic Circle, bordered by the Southern Ocean. With a surface area of 14,200,000 km2, Antarctica is the fifth-largest continent, being nearly twice the size of Australia and larger than Europe (5,500,000 sq mi). Ice blankets the majority of Antarctica, with an average thickness of 1.9 km (1.2 mi).

The continent with the greatest average elevation is Antarctica, which also tends to be the coldest, driest, and windiest overall. With around 200 mm (8 in) of yearly precipitation at the shore and much less inland, it is primarily a polar desert.

A car has a velocity of 25 m/s and a mass of 3500 kg. What is the cars momentum?
gtnhenbr [62]

Answer:

87,500 kg-m/s

Step-by-step explanation:

Momentum = Mass * velocity

3500*25 = 87,500
